    Michael Annett, former NASCAR winner has passed at age 39

    6 days ago

    Former NASCAR driver Michael Annett has passed away. Annett climbed from the ARCA Menards Series to the NASCAR Cup Series. He ran with JR Motorsports in the Xfinity Series from 2017-2021.He was a Daytona winner with JR Motorsports. He won the season opener in the 2019 NASCAR Xfinity Series season. He also spent three years in the NASCAR Cup Series. He raced for Tommy Baldwin Racing (2014), HScott Motorsports (2015), Hillman-Circle Sport LLC (2015) and H Scott Motorsports (2016).Annett was 39 years old. At this time, there is no further information on his death. JR Motorsports posted the following on Friday night:“Our thoughts and prayers are with the entire Annett family with the passing of our friend Michael Annett,” JR Motorsports posted.The team added, “Michael was a key member of JRM from 2017 until he retired in 2021 and was an important part in turning us into the four-car organization we remain today.”Annett suffered a leg injury and retired following the 2021 season. Justin Allgaier ran as a teammate to Annett at JR Motorsports. On Saturday, he issued the following statement:“My heart hurts for Michael and his family,” Justin Allgaier opened.He added, “We had a lot of good memories together on and off the track.
